Google accidentally sent free money to some of its users in April 2023. The incident occurred due to a bug in Google Pay’s reward program, resulting in random cashback rewards being sent to users ranging from $10 to $1,000.
Google has acknowledged the issue and stated that they are working to fix the bug and refund any mistakenly sent money. However, some users have already spent the free money, which poses a challenge for Google to recover.
This incident has raised concerns about the security of Google’s payment system and the effectiveness of its error reporting mechanism. Nevertheless, Google has assured its users that it is taking steps to prevent similar incidents from happening in the future.
